The surname Berriobeña is of Spanish origin and is believed to have originated in the Basque region of Spain. The name is derived from the Basque words "berri," meaning new, and "obe," meaning a mill or a wetland. This suggests that the surname may have originally referred to someone who lived near a new mill or a wetland area.
The meaning of the surname Berriobeña can be interpreted as "new mill" or "new wetland," which reflects the geographical or occupational origins of the surname. It is likely that the surname was originally used to identify individuals or families who lived or worked in proximity to a new mill or wetland area in the Basque region.
Like many surnames, the Berriobeña surname may have variations in spelling or form. Some common variations of the surname include Berriobena, Berriobenea, and Berriobeñe. These variations may have evolved over time due to regional dialects, spelling changes, or transcription errors.
According to data from the Instituto Nacional de Estadística (INE), the incidence of the Berriobeña surname in Spain is relatively low, with only 17 occurrences recorded. The surname is most commonly found in the Basque region of Spain, particularly in the provinces of Bizkaia and Gipuzkoa.
